Description
AOD480 Overview
An op amp's input capacitance is defined as the capacitance between both of its input terminals with either input grounded, and 820pF @ 15V is its maximum input capacitance.The drain current is the maximum continuous current the device can conduct, and this device has 25A continuous drain current (ID).Peak drain current is 45A, which is the maximum pulsed drain current.Normal operation requires that the DS breakdown voltage remain above 30V.For this transistor to work, a voltage 30V is required between drain and source (Vdss).Using drive voltage (4.5V 10V), this device contributes to a reduction in overall power consumption.
